In recent months, the small but resilient community of Fairplay has found itself at the forefront of a significant environmental battle. As plans to build a waste incinerator near the town advance, locals have banded together to resist what they see as a threat to their health, environment, and way of life.

The Rise of the Incinerator Proposal

The proposal for a waste incinerator has been met with mixed reactions from officials and the public. Proponents argue that the incinerator could help manage the increasing waste crisis in the region and generate energy through waste-to-energy technology. However, many community members worry about the potential health hazards associated with incineration, including air quality deterioration and increased exposure to harmful pollutants.

Community Mobilization

Since the announcement of the proposal, residents have organized various initiatives to voice their concerns. Community meetings have seen attendance swell, with residents sharing testimonies and scientific research supporting their opposition to the incinerator. Activist groups have emerged, advocating for cleaner, more sustainable waste management alternatives.

Public Demonstrations

One of the most significant actions taken by the community was a large-scale public demonstration, which drew hundreds of participants to the streets of Fairplay. Protesters carried signs reading, “Not in Our Backyard!” and “Clean Energy, Not Incinerators!” The event received significant media coverage, amplifying the community’s message beyond local borders.

Local Leaders Join the Fight

As resistance grows, local leaders and officials have begun to take notice. Some council members have voiced their support for the community’s concerns, echoing calls for more extensive studies on the health impacts of the incinerator. Calls for transparency have also increased, with advocates demanding that all studies be available for public scrutiny.

Facing Challenges

Despite the growing opposition, the proponents of the incinerator remain steadfast. They argue that the facility would create jobs and stimulate the local economy. However, this argument has not swayed many residents, who prioritize health and environmental sustainability. Challenges remain, as state officials must weigh the benefits against community concerns before moving forward with the proposal.
